Prescott 4th of July Fireworks

The City of Prescott says the annual fireworks display is on track to take place again over Watson Lake. The city’s Fourth of July celebration is being planned from 3 to 9:30 or 10 p.m., Monday, July 4, with the
fireworks starting at about 9 p.m. Each year, and especially when drought conditions
are severe, the city faces questions from the public about whether the fireworks
would take place. This year, Recreation Services Director Joe Baynes said, “It will go
